Job Summary:
This position will report to the Manager, Accounts Payable Shared Services and support the Comcast utility bill process automation and sustainability initiatives. Duties include analysis, reporting, process design, configuration, development, testing and support on third party application. In addition, the person in this position should possess strong technical skills, a thorough understanding of application and process design, and excellent problem solving skills. Comcast will provide application specific training and certification.
Core Responsibilities:
• Design, develop and deploy automation robots that retrieval invoices from websites, extract bills metadata and interface transactions into accounts payable.
• Collaborate with management and peers on targeting and prioritization of utility companies for integration into the automated processing software
• Partner with the utility management team define requirements and capture data needed to reduce energy costs and carbon footprint.
